ERP系統工作流基本知識介紹

2021-03-03 22:09:13 字數 4479 閱讀 6676

上海益達網路科技****

目錄1 工作流基本概念 4

1.1 工作流的起源 4

1.2 工作流的定義 4

2 工作流管理系統基本概念 8

2.1 工作流管理系統的定義 8

2.2 工作流管理系統的分類 9

3 工作流管理系統參考模型 10

3.1 工作流管理系統體系結構 10

3.2 工作流參考模型 11

3.3 過程定義 13

3.3.1 過程定義工具 13

3.3.2 工作流定義轉換(介面1) 14

3.4 工作流執行服務與工作流引擎 15

3.5 工作流客戶端功能 17

3.5.1 工作流客戶應用 17

3.5.2 客戶端應用介面 18

3.6 應用程式呼叫功能 18

3.6.1 應用程式呼叫 18

3.6.2 應用程式呼叫介面 19

3.7 系統管理 20

3.7.1 管理和監控工具 20

3.7.2 管理和監控工具介面 21

4 過程定義語言 23

5 益達網路eos工作流 26

5.1 益達網路eos概述 26

5.2 eos工作流組成 27

5.3 eos工作流特性 27

5.4 eos工作流優勢 31

5.5 eos工作流應用範圍 32

6 工作流的發展趨勢和應用 34

6.1 工作流的發展現狀 34

6.2 採用工作流的好處 35

6.3 工作流與erp系統的應用 35

參考文獻 37

附錄:術語表 38

工作流的概念起源於生產組織和辦公自動化領域,提出的目的是通過將工作分解成定義良好的任務、角色,按照一定的規則和過程來執行這些任務並對它們進行監控,達到提高工作效率、降低生產成本、提高企業生產經營管理水平和企業競爭力的目標。實際上,自從進入工業化時代以來,有關過程的組織管理與流程的優化工作就一直在進行,這是企業管理的主要研究內容之一,只是在沒有引入計算機資訊系統的支援之前,這些工作都是由人工來完成的。在計算機網路技術和分布式資料庫技術迅速發展,多機協同工作技術日益成熟的基礎上,於20世紀80年代中期發展起來的工作流技術為企業更好地實現這些經營目標提供了先進的手段。

工作流技術一出現馬上就得到廣泛的重視和研究。至今工作流管理技術已成功地運用到圖書館、醫院、保險公司、銀行等行業,然而它更重要的應用還是在工業領域,特別是製造業領域。

目前,在全球範圍內,對工作流的技術研究以及相關的產品開發進入了更為繁榮的階段,更多更新的技術被整合進來,檔案管理系統、資料庫、電子郵件、inter***服務等都已被容納到工作流管理系統之中。工作流產品的市場每年以兩位數字的速度迅猛增長。市場上工作流產品發展迅速,據統計,2023年工作流產品的增長率超過35%。

作為支援企業經營過程重組(business process reengineering, bpr)、經營過程自動化(business process automation, bpa)的一種手段,工作流技術的研究應用日益受到學術界與企業界的重視。

根據國際工作流管理聯盟(workflow management coalition,wfmc) 的定義,工作流(workflow)就是自動運作的業務過程部分或整體,表現為參與者對檔案、資訊或任務按照規程採取行動,並令其在參與者之間傳遞。簡單地說,工作流就是一系列相互銜接、自動進行的業務活動或任務。我們可以將整個業務過程看作是一條河,其中流過的就是工作流。

我們從工作流定義中可以看出,工作流是經營過程的乙個計算機實現,而工作流管理系統則是這一實現的軟體環境。使用工作流來作為經營過程的實現技術首先要求工作流系統能夠反映經營過程的如下幾個方面的問題,即經營過程是什麼(由哪些活動、任務組成,也就是結構上的定義)、怎麼做(活動間的執行條件、規則以及所互動的資訊,也就是控制流與資訊流的定義)、由誰來做(人或計算機應用程式,也就是組織角色的定義)、做得怎樣(通過工作流管理系統對執行過程進行監控)。圖1-1給出了乙個稱為工作流傘的示意圖,反映了工作流覆蓋的經營過程的範圍與對應的工作流研究領域。

圖1-1 工作流傘

在企業應用中,工作流經常與經營過程重組相聯絡,完成對乙個組織(或機構)中核心經營過程(或者成為關鍵經營過程)的建模、評價分析和操作的實施。雖然並非所有的bpr都需要採用工作流的方式進行實施,但是,工作流技術通常是實施bpr的乙個較好的方法,因為工作流提供了經營過程邏輯與它的資訊支撐系統的分離,並實現了應用邏輯和過程邏輯分離,這種方式在進行企業實際應用時具有顯著的優點。它可以在不修改具體功能模組實現方式(硬體環境、作業系統、資料庫系統、程式語言、應用開發工具、使用者介面)的情況下,通過修改(重新定義)過程模型來改進系統效能,實現對生產經營過程部分或全部地整合管理,有效地把人、資訊和應用工具合理地組織在一起,提高軟體的重用率,發揮系統的最大效能。

如上所述,工作流主要是用來描述經營過程的,因此,乙個工作流就可以看成是企業的乙個具體的經營過程的抽象或圖示化的表示。那麼如何才描述清楚乙個企業的經營過程呢?主要應該說明以下幾個問題:

這個經營過程要做什麼?即其目標或想達到的目的是什麼?

這個經營過程是如何完成的,有哪些任務並經過哪些步驟完成?

這個經營過程有誰參與完成,有哪些部門參與?

這個經營過程用了哪些方式或手段來完成?

為了說明以上四個問題,並且以計算機可以識別的方式建立企業經營過程模型,在工作流中必須定義一系列的基本概念和術語來描述模型的組成,從而實現對企業經營過程的建模。首先是工作流的定義,如我們在前面介紹的,工作流就是將一組任務組織起來完成某個經營過程。所以,工作流整個模型就是為了說明經營過程的目的,或者說這個模型描述的經營過程的目標。

工作流中兩個最基本的元素是活動和活動之間的連線關係。活動對應於經營過程中的任務,主要是反映經營過程中的執行動作或操作。活動之間的連線關係代表了經營過程的規則和業務過程。

當然,乙個企業的業務過程不是僅有活動和活動之間的連線關係就能夠描述清楚的。乙個企業的經營過程還要涉及參與操作的人員、組織、所操作的資料、使用了哪些電腦程式等。在工作流模型中通過定義活動的角色(操作人員)和組織單元(組織機構、部門)來描述企業的經營過程是由誰來完成的。

另外,通過定義工作應用程式來說明採用說明手段完成經營過程。

下面我們用乙個簡單的例子來說明可以採用工作流建模方法進行描述的經營過程。

例:客戶到銀行取款的處理過程。

圖1-2 銀行客戶的取款過程

該流程的具體意義如下:

1) 客戶填寫取款單;

2) 銀行出納接收取款單和客戶的存摺;

3) 銀行出納檢查客戶存款資訊;

如果餘額不足,要求客戶重新填寫取款單,返回步驟1);

存款餘額足夠,則繼續進行;

4) 客戶輸入密碼;

如果密碼正確,繼續進行;

如果密碼有誤,重新輸入,如果連續三次輸入錯誤,則退出;

5) 出納取出相應的現金,並在客戶的存摺上進行記錄;

6) 將存摺和現金交給客戶。

上面例子中的方框表示經營過程中的任務,它們對應於工作流中的活動。方框之間的連線弧表示活動之間的關聯。這個例子表明了工作流技術具有廣泛的應用背景,它可以用直觀的、使用者非常容易理解的方式來描述日常的事務處理活動和企業的經營過程。

根據wfmc的定義,工作流管理系統(workflow management system, wfms)是乙個軟體系統,它完成工作流的定義和管理,並按照在計算機中預先定義好的工作流邏輯推進工作流例項的執行。

通常,工作流管理系統是指執行在乙個或多個工作流引擎上用於定義、實現和管理工作流執行的一套軟體系統,它與工作流執行者(人、應用)互動,推進工作流例項的執行,並監控工作流的執行狀態。

雖然不同的工作流管理系統具有不同的應用範圍和不同的實施方式,但它們具有很多共同的特性。從比較高的層次上來抽象地考察工作流管理系統,可以發現所有的工作流管理系統都提供了3種功能(如圖2-1):

1) 建立階段的功能:主要考慮工作流過程和相關活動的定義和建模功能。

2) 執行階段的控制功能:在一定的執行環境下,執行工作流過程,並完成每個過程中活動的排序和排程功能。

3) 執行階段的人機互動功能:實現各種活動執行過程中使用者與it應用工具之間的互動。

圖2-1 工作流管理系統的特性

根據所實現的業務過程,工作流管理系統可分為四類:

1) 管理型工作流:在這類工作流中活動可以預定義,並且有一套簡單的任務協調規則。

2) 設定型工作流:與管理型工作流相似,但一般用來處理異常或發生機會比較小的情況,有時甚至是只出現一次的情況,這與參與的使用者有關。

3) 協作型工作流:參與者和協作的次數較多。

4) 生產型工作:實現重要的業務過程的工作流,特別是與業務組織的功能直接相關的工作流。

根據底層實現技術,可將工作流產品分為三類:

1) 以通訊為中心:以電子郵件為底層的通訊機制。這種型別的工作流管理系統適合於協作型工作流和不確定型工作流,而不適合於生產型工作流。

ERP系統中的工作流和業務流

工作流 將工作分解成幾段不同的任務,然後通過一定的規則和過程來執行這些任務並對它們進行監控,達到提高工作效率,降低生產成本,提高企業競爭力等目的.它大多應用於辦公自動化領域.業務流 它是企業內部資源之間的資料流動,一般通過企業資源計畫系統 erp 對企業中的物流 資金流和資訊流進行全面整合管理.但是...

閥門基本知識介紹

閥門基本知識培訓 1 閥門的分類 1.1 按閥門的用途分 a 截斷用 截斷管路中介質。如 閘閥 截止閥 球閥 旋塞閥 蝶閥等 b 止回用 防止介質倒流。如 止回閥 c 調節用 調節壓力和流量。如 調節閥 減壓閥 節流閥 蝶閥 v形開口球閥 平衡閥等 d 分配用 改變管路中介質流向,分配介質。如 分配...

電鍍基本知識介紹

磨光 除掉零件表明的毛刺 鏽蝕 劃痕 焊縫 焊瘤 砂眼 氧化皮等各種巨集觀缺陷 以提高零件的平整度和電鍍質量。拋光 拋光的目的是進一步降低零件表面的粗糙度 獲得光亮的外觀。有機械拋光 化學拋光 電化學拋光等方式。脫脂除油 除掉工件表面油脂。有有機溶劑除油 化學除油 電化學除油 擦拭除油 滾筒除油等手...